Imagine being given the chance to play one of the most iconic figures in culinary history, a man whose life was marked by both creativity and turmoil. For Dominic Sessa, landing the role of 19-year-old Anthony Bourdain in the biopic 'Tony' was a dream come true, but it also came with a unique set of challenges. In a conversation with Cybers Pulse News, Sessa opens up about how being a 'liar' helped him portray the famed writer and cook, working with mentor figures like Antonio Banderas, and how the film foreshadows Bourdain's later struggles.

'Tony' is a coming-of-age film set in 1975, a time before Bourdain became a household name, thanks to his books like 'Kitchen Confidential' and 'Medium Raw', and his Emmy-winning show 'Parts Unknown'. The movie follows a young Bourdain, who goes by 'Tony', as he follows his older school crush, Nancy, to Provincetown, Massachusetts, where he lands a job in a local kitchen. The film offers a fresh take on Bourdain's life, focusing on a summer that changed his life forever.
For Sessa, who had his breakout role in Alexander Payne's 2023 film 'The Holdovers', 'Tony' presented an opportunity to step into his first lead role. However, he was initially skeptical about taking on the part, thinking it would be a traditional biopic covering Bourdain's entire life.

'Tony' is more than just a biopic; it's a coming-of-age story that delves into the complexities of Bourdain's early life. The film's director, Matt Johnson, decided to focus on a specific summer in Bourdain's life, giving Sessa and the rest of the cast a wide-open canvas to work with. This approach allowed Sessa to bring a new perspective to the character, one that was relatable and true to his own experiences.
“I personally find it more interesting when you can reveal to the audience something that is not really known or hasn’t been focused on at all,” Sessa explains. “Even for the biggest fans of Bourdain, they feel like they’re seeing something new here.”
Sessa's portrayal of Bourdain is not just about the character's writing and cooking skills but also about his flaws and imperfections. In the film, Bourdain is a young man struggling to find his place in the world, and Sessa's performance captures this vulnerability.

Working with director Matt Johnson was instrumental in Sessa's ability to get comfortable with the role. Johnson's approach to the film was more about creating a coming-of-age story than a traditional biopic, which allowed Sessa to bring a unique perspective to the character.
“I felt I actually had a way to understand the character that was relatable to me and true to the things that I’ve experienced,” Sessa says of Johnson’s approach. This understanding of the character's struggles and imperfections is what makes Sessa's portrayal of Bourdain so compelling.
